Transaction 284110e75731fdc862ea16bcd16fcc77e2db4b3760abbec29a6b1664d416a5b7
1 Input
2 Outputs
- 284110e75731fdc862ea16bcd16fcc77e2db4b3760abbec29a6b1664d416a5b7:0
- 284110e75731fdc862ea16bcd16fcc77e2db4b3760abbec29a6b1664d416a5b7:1
value 428447
address 3Hv8o3Wca5BuV34dRW7KYHrGzSieB6hN2t
value 6999277
address 12Rd1a6ST26xiJcbAhTVczNL2VGNk9iUdo